LT Headers and Emissions Tests

The guys with LT headers in Harris, Brazoria and Galveston will eventually be faced with emissions testing to get there inspection sticker. I would love to get LT's, but not if it is going to cause me trouble at inspection time.

I know the exhaust will pass, but will they hook up to the car's ECM and see diagnostic problems? I understand that with LT's the cats are moved back and don't heat up quick enough to satisfy the ECM. Do you get a tune to cancel any thrown codes to pass? I read about O2 sensor extensions, what do they do?

Am I doomed to not have LT headers because I live in Brazoria county? What are you guys with LT's going to do?

we install them here all the time and we are in the dfw area
you will deff need a tune with long tubes to keep the light from coming on
we have no had any issues with any of the cars we have done in the past passing emissions as long as you have the high flow cats and the tune

to my knowledge here in the dfw are at least the newer cars that are obdII they just plug into it at the obd port i have not seen them put the sniffer in the newer vehicles and on my trucks that are newer all they have done is plug into the port
but like on my 89 the put the sniffer in the exhaust but i have no trouble passing i have a ls1 in it with long tubes and highflow cats and have not had a single issue
